How the Talon 22 Addresses Key Trail Running Challenges

The Osprey Talon 22 is designed to offer that ideal solution. This isn’t just a scaled-down backpacking pack; it’s purpose-built for the unique demands of fast-paced trail running.

FeatureExplanation
BioStretch Harness and HipbeltThe continuous wrap of breathable mesh on the harness and hipbelt provides a close-to-body fit that minimizes bounce. This helps a runner, particularly on steep descents where a shifting pack can throw off balance, maintain stability and speed, addressing the consequences of wasted energy and potential falls.
AirScape BackpanelThis backpanel utilizes foam ridges covered in mesh, creating channels for airflow. This feature reduces sweat buildup for a runner tackling a long climb on a hot day. It prevents the feeling of a clammy, overheated back, directly combating the discomfort and potential for chafing that can plague runners in humid conditions.
External Hydration SleeveA dedicated sleeve separate from the main compartment allows for quick and easy refilling of a hydration reservoir (sold separately) without unpacking the entire bag. This feature addresses the need for efficient hydration on long runs, where time spent fumbling with gear translates to lost minutes and potential dehydration.
Multiple Pockets and Attachment PointsStretch-mesh side pockets, hipbelt pockets, a large front shove-it pocket, and trekking pole attachment points provide organized storage and quick access to essentials. This allows a runner to grab a gel, adjust layers, or stow trekking poles without breaking stride, directly addressing the problem of inefficient gear management that can slow down a run.

The Talon 22 synergistically incorporates these solutions. The BioStretch harness, hipbelt, and AirScape backpanel create a stable and comfortable carrying experience.

Moreover, the external hydration sleeve and multiple pockets, designed with the runner’s workflow in mind, allow for seamless access to essentials. It’s not just about having these features; it’s about how they work together to create a pack that feels almost invisible, even when fully loaded.

Potential Drawbacks of the Talon 22

No product is perfect, and the Talon 22 is no exception. While it excels in many areas, there are a few potential drawbacks.

Durability of lightweight materials. Pursuing a lightweight design means some materials may be less durable than those in heavier packs. While we found the materials sufficiently robust for most trail running scenarios, aggressive bushwhacking or extremely rough use might lead to faster wear and tear.

Limited capacity for heavier loads. While the 22-liter capacity is ample for most day trips and even some ultralight overnights, it’s not designed for carrying heavy loads. If you regularly need to haul a significant amount of gear, a larger-volume pack might be a better choice.

Hipbelt pocket size. The hipbelt pockets, while convenient for small items, might be too small for some larger smartphones. While this isn’t a dealbreaker, it’s something to consider if you rely on your phone for navigation or communication. (The Gregory Pace 6, a direct competitor, addresses this issue.)
